Full Description


Description of the building
The Main House offers about 320m² living area on 2 floors; further 50m² on the second floor need to be restored.
Ground floor : Hall 40m² with a stately stone staircase and wrought iron railing, lounge 90m² with beautiful vaulted ceilings, kitchen 32m² with vaulted exposed brick ceiling, study with fire place 25m². Utility and heating room 25m², guest WC.
1st floor : The stairs lead up to an attractive gallery area with wrought iron railings crowned by a chandelier. The master suite is 50m² with its own bathroom, WC and dressing room. There is a second ensuite bedroom 15m², two further bedrooms of 17m², a shower room and WC.
2nd Floor: 50m² with a shower room and WC to restore.

Apartment 90m²
It is situated on the 1st floor above the kitchen and dining room with independant beautiful stone staircase. It needs total restoration.
Apartment 90m²
On the second floor, just above the other one.

Outbuilding
Garage / Stone Barn 135m²
Hen house 25m²

Grounds
There are exactly 1.3888 hectares of luscious enclosed gardens. The back of the house, a lovely courtyard with a separate access, has a barbeque area and could be a place for a swimming pool. To the front of the house, outdoor eating areas befitting a Manet masterpiece have been carefully chosen under the shade of the trees.  A corner has been crated with hedges, a another large space for a swimming pool. The remaining garden is luscious and leafy and leads out to a paddock set against the backdrop of sunflower fields. 2 wells are providing the water for the property. A Stone basin could be restored and the relaxing water sound would add to the already lovely ambiance. Septic tank.

General condition
The house is in perfect condition and tastefully decorated. With underfloor heating downstairs double glazed wooden joinery,  wooden shutters, old and modern floor tiles.

Comment
A beautiful house recently renovated with taste and delicacy using quality materials. Charming garden and amenities within easy access distance. Potential for conversion and commercial activity.
